Output e7b70ecb434a98649705566af14fb7de20fb2a88a94282d4070d1eacd278452a:0

value
1353891
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c872bea31b4359f6adaa33306879b47fa092ae0 OP_EQUAL
address
32qFxjF2z52S8AjrcWrNZhX3sGQJNRxnV7
transaction
e7b70ecb434a98649705566af14fb7de20fb2a88a94282d4070d1eacd278452a
spent
true